    copied!<p>Use a standard sql query (pivots are expensive in terms of performance) and create a custom pivot function in your server side code. Here are a couple of examples.</p> <pre><code>''' &lt;summary&gt; ''' Pivots columnX as new columns for the X axis (must be unique values) and the remaining columns as ''' the Y axis. Optionally can include columns to exclude from the Y axis. ''' &lt;/summary&gt; ''' &lt;param name="dt"&gt;&lt;/param&gt; ''' &lt;param name="columnX"&gt;&lt;/param&gt; ''' &lt;param name="columnsToIgnore"&gt;&lt;/param&gt; ''' &lt;returns&gt;DataTable&lt;/returns&gt; ''' &lt;remarks&gt;&lt;/remarks&gt; Public Shared Function Pivot(ByVal dt As DataTable, ByVal columnX As String, ByVal ParamArray columnsToIgnore As String()) As DataTable Dim dt2 As New DataTable() If columnX = "" Then columnX = dt.Columns(0).ColumnName End If 'Add a Column at the beginning of the table dt2.Columns.Add(columnX) 'Read all DISTINCT values from columnX Column in the provided DataTable Dim columnXValues As New List(Of String)() 'Create the list of columns to ignore Dim listColumnsToIgnore As New List(Of String)() If columnsToIgnore.Length &gt; 0 Then listColumnsToIgnore.AddRange(columnsToIgnore) End If If Not listColumnsToIgnore.Contains(columnX) Then listColumnsToIgnore.Add(columnX) End If ' Add the X axis columns For Each dr As DataRow In dt.Rows Dim columnXTemp As String = dr(columnX).ToString() If Not columnXValues.Contains(columnXTemp) Then columnXValues.Add(columnXTemp) dt2.Columns.Add(columnXTemp) Else Throw New Exception("The inversion used must have unique values for column " + columnX) End If Next 'Add a row for each non-columnX of the DataTable For Each dc As DataColumn In dt.Columns If Not columnXValues.Contains(dc.ColumnName) AndAlso Not listColumnsToIgnore.Contains(dc.ColumnName) Then Dim dr As DataRow = dt2.NewRow() dr(0) = dc.ColumnName dt2.Rows.Add(dr) End If Next 'Complete the datatable with the values For i As Integer = 0 To dt2.Rows.Count - 1 For j As Integer = 1 To dt2.Columns.Count - 1 dt2.Rows(i)(j) = dt.Rows(j - 1)(dt2.Rows(i)(0).ToString()).ToString() Next Next Return dt2 End Function ''' &lt;summary&gt; ''' Can pivot any column as X, any column as Y, and any column as Z. Sort on X, sort on Y and optionally, the ''' values at the intersection of x and y (Z axis) can be summed. ''' &lt;/summary&gt; ''' &lt;param name="dt"&gt;&lt;/param&gt; ''' &lt;param name="columnX"&gt;&lt;/param&gt; ''' &lt;param name="columnY"&gt;&lt;/param&gt; ''' &lt;param name="columnZ"&gt;&lt;/param&gt; ''' &lt;param name="nullValue"&gt;&lt;/param&gt; ''' &lt;param name="sumValues"&gt;&lt;/param&gt; ''' &lt;param name="xSort"&gt;&lt;/param&gt; ''' &lt;param name="ySort"&gt;&lt;/param&gt; ''' &lt;returns&gt;DataTable&lt;/returns&gt; ''' &lt;remarks&gt;&lt;/remarks&gt; Public Shared Function Pivot(ByVal dt As DataTable, ByVal columnX As String, ByVal columnY As String, ByVal columnZ As String, _ ByVal nullValue As String, ByVal sumValues As Boolean, ByVal xSort As Sort, ByVal ySort As Sort) As DataTable Dim dt2 As New DataTable() Dim tickList As List(Of Long) = Nothing If columnX = "" Then columnX = dt.Columns(0).ColumnName End If 'Add a Column at the beginning of the table dt2.Columns.Add(columnY) 'Read all DISTINCT values from columnX Column in the provided DataTable Dim columnXValues As New List(Of String)() Dim cols As Integer = 0 For Each dr As DataRow In dt.Rows If dr(columnX).ToString.Contains("'") Then dr(columnX) = dr(columnX).ToString.Replace("'", "") End If If Not columnXValues.Contains(dr(columnX).ToString) Then 'Read each row value, if it's different from others provided, 'add to the list of values and creates a new Column with its value. columnXValues.Add(dr(columnX).ToString) End If Next 'Sort X if needed If Not xSort = Sort.None Then columnXValues = SortValues(columnXValues, xSort) End If 'Add columnX For Each s As String In columnXValues dt2.Columns.Add(s) Next 'Verify Y and Z Axis columns were provided If columnY &lt;&gt; "" AndAlso columnZ &lt;&gt; "" Then 'Read DISTINCT Values for Y Axis Column Dim columnYValues As New List(Of String)() For Each dr As DataRow In dt.Rows If dr(columnY).ToString.Contains("'") Then dr(columnY) = dr(columnY).ToString.Replace("'", "") End If If Not columnYValues.Contains(dr(columnY).ToString()) Then columnYValues.Add(dr(columnY).ToString()) End If Next ' Now we can sort the Y axis if needed. If Not ySort = Sort.None Then columnYValues = SortValues(columnYValues, ySort) End If 'Loop all Distinct ColumnY Values For Each columnYValue As String In columnYValues 'Create a new Row Dim drReturn As DataRow = dt2.NewRow() drReturn(0) = columnYValue Dim rows As DataRow() = dt.[Select](columnY + "='" + columnYValue + "'") 'Read each row to fill the DataTable For Each dr As DataRow In rows Dim rowColumnTitle As String = dr(columnX).ToString() 'Read each column to fill the DataTable For Each dc As DataColumn In dt2.Columns If dc.ColumnName = rowColumnTitle Then 'If sumValues, try to perform a Sum 'If sum is not possible due to value types, use the nullValue string If sumValues Then If IsNumeric(dr(columnZ).ToString) Then drReturn(rowColumnTitle) = Val(drReturn(rowColumnTitle).ToString) + Val(dr(columnZ).ToString) Else drReturn(rowColumnTitle) = nullValue End If Else drReturn(rowColumnTitle) = dr(columnZ).ToString End If End If Next Next dt2.Rows.Add(drReturn) Next Else Throw New Exception("The columns to perform inversion are not provided") End If 'if nullValue param was provided, fill the datable with it If nullValue &lt;&gt; "" Then For Each dr As DataRow In dt2.Rows For Each dc As DataColumn In dt2.Columns If dr(dc.ColumnName).ToString() = "" Then dr(dc.ColumnName) = nullValue End If Next Next End If Return dt2 End Function ''' &lt;summary&gt; ''' Sorts a list of strings checking to see if they are numeric or date types. ''' &lt;/summary&gt; ''' &lt;param name="list"&gt;&lt;/param&gt; ''' &lt;param name="srt"&gt;&lt;/param&gt; ''' &lt;returns&gt;&lt;/returns&gt; ''' &lt;remarks&gt;&lt;/remarks&gt; Private Shared Function SortValues(ByVal list As List(Of String), ByVal srt As Sort) As List(Of String) Dim tickList As List(Of Long) = Nothing Dim dblList As List(Of Double) = Nothing ' Figure out how to sort columnX For Each s As String In list Dim colDate As Date = Nothing If Date.TryParse(s, colDate) Then tickList = New List(Of Long) Exit For End If Next Dim dateTicks As Long If Not tickList Is Nothing Then For Each s As String In list dateTicks = DateTime.Parse(s).Ticks If Not tickList.Contains(dateTicks) Then tickList.Add(dateTicks) End If Next If srt = Sort.DESC Then tickList.Sort() tickList.Reverse() ElseIf srt = Sort.ASC Then tickList.Sort() End If list.Clear() For Each lng As Long In tickList list.Add(New Date(lng).ToString("G")) Next Else Dim dbl As Double = Nothing For Each s As String In list If IsNumeric(s) Then dblList = New List(Of Double) End If Next If Not dblList Is Nothing Then 'Doubles or Integers For Each s As String In list dbl = Val(s) If Not dblList.Contains(dbl) Then dblList.Add(dbl) End If Next If srt = Sort.DESC Then dblList.Sort() dblList.Reverse() ElseIf srt = Sort.ASC Then dblList.Sort() End If list.Clear() For Each d As Double In dblList list.Add(d.ToString) Next Else 'Strings If srt = Sort.DESC Then list.Sort() list.Reverse() ElseIf srt = Sort.ASC Then list.Sort() End If End If End If Return list End Function </code></pre>
